This repository contains my first battle in the ZK war. My enemy: Groth16.
☆17Nov 23, 2023Updated 2 years ago
Alternatives and similar repositories for Groth16
Users that are interested in Groth16 are comparing it to the libraries listed below. We may earn a commission when you buy through links labeled 'Ad' on this page.
Sorting:
- Groth16 implementation in Python. Final project of RareSkills ZK bootcamp cohort 8.☆24Aug 28, 2025Updated 6 months ago
- Exercises for Part 2 of the ZK-book☆33Oct 31, 2024Updated last year
- Ethereum zkEVM book☆82Sep 30, 2025Updated 5 months ago
- Implementation of zero knowledge proof protocol - Groth16, Plonk. For education purposes. Not a production ready code.☆80Dec 23, 2023Updated 2 years ago
- My work for Rareskills ZK Book.☆78Jan 29, 2024Updated 2 years ago
- Hashing circuits implemented in circom☆28Jan 24, 2025Updated last year
- ☆12Nov 3, 2024Updated last year
- BN254 Pairing Implementation in Noir☆23Aug 23, 2023Updated 2 years ago
- Create a Stark prover & verifier from zero☆69Feb 17, 2026Updated last month
- ☆21Mar 27, 2022Updated 3 years ago
- ☆27Oct 15, 2023Updated 2 years ago
- CompChomper is a framework for measuring how LLMs perform at code completion.☆21Apr 29, 2025Updated 10 months ago
- Arithmetic over the M31 or BabyBear field in Bitcoin Script☆25Jul 24, 2024Updated last year
- Source code for "Building Cryptographic Proofs from Hash Functions"☆226Dec 4, 2025Updated 3 months ago
- Python3 implementation of Bulletproofs - non-interactive zero-knowledge proof protocol with very short proofs and without a trusted setup…☆28Dec 8, 2022Updated 3 years ago
- A monorepo of reusable crates for zero-knowledge technologies.☆22Feb 8, 2026Updated last month
- ☆28Jan 12, 2026Updated 2 months ago
- Source files for ZKDL Lectures☆24Nov 17, 2025Updated 4 months ago
- ☆11Sep 10, 2024Updated last year
- MoonMath Manual notes, exercise solution and extra comments.☆32Jun 28, 2024Updated last year
- MerkleTree compatible with circomlib☆12Feb 24, 2026Updated last month
- This repo introduces Plonky3 and showcases a simple implementation of fibonacci constraints and execution trace.☆42Jun 29, 2025Updated 8 months ago
- On-chain Ethereum light client built with SP1☆80Dec 16, 2025Updated 3 months ago
- specs & benchmarks for the ZPrize 3 - High Throughput Signature Verification☆10Oct 9, 2023Updated 2 years ago
- Expander Compiler☆42Mar 12, 2026Updated last week
- Solutions to exercises from MoonMath Manual to zkSNARKs.☆93Dec 28, 2025Updated 2 months ago
- Turing machine ZKVM☆10Nov 12, 2023Updated 2 years ago
- Formalisation of the linear lambda calculus in Coq☆10Dec 2, 2018Updated 7 years ago
- Formalization in Coq of algorithms used in compilers for the Compiler.org project☆15Dec 22, 2018Updated 7 years ago
- zkLean is a domain specific language (DSL) in Lean for specifying zero-knowledge statements☆24Feb 18, 2026Updated last month
- ☆25Jan 10, 2024Updated 2 years ago
- An efficient, lazy suffix tree implementation☆13Dec 10, 2020Updated 5 years ago
- ♨️ Highest Throughput EVM L2 PoC, ThreadSafe Execution ♨️☆16Mar 18, 2024Updated 2 years ago
- Exercises to learn the syntax of Circom and create EVM compatible zero knowledge programs.☆335Apr 4, 2025Updated 11 months ago
- gnark-rollup-ex☆11Aug 5, 2020Updated 5 years ago
- This is creating a TCP Server using Rust programming language☆14Oct 3, 2023Updated 2 years ago
- Kolu is an identification friend or foe (IFF) system for drones - European Defense Tech Hackathon 2025 LDN☆11Sep 28, 2025Updated 5 months ago
- A Rust implementation of the Groth16 zkSNARK☆337Aug 11, 2025Updated 7 months ago
- Fast Setup for Proof by Reflection, in Two Lines of Ltac.☆14Jan 12, 2021Updated 5 years ago